All in all, the explosion yesterday in a Twitter post revealed more than 25 different sandwiches in Los Angeles, from 63-year-old Connal’s under $ 6 shredders in Pasadena to a $ 9 three-tip sandwich at Handy Market. Burbank is only available on weekends.
Since spiking less than 24 hours ago, the original tweet has garnered more than 10,000 retweets and nearly 100,000 likes. Others have begun to tune in with their own under-$ 10 selection, including options like Porto’s feta cheese sandwiches and vegetarian wraps from Hy Mart in North Hollywood.
